G7 Backs Israel’s Right To Defend Itself, Calls Iran ‘Source Of Terror’ As Middle East Conflict Escalates

by aweeincm

<p>Ahead of the critical G7 Summit meeting in Canada, leaders of the forum have issued a statement on the ongoing conflict in West Asia, reiterating their commitment to peace while endorsing Israel’s right to defend itself.</p>
<p>”We, the leaders of the G7, reiterate our commitment to peace and stability in the Middle East. In this context, we affirm that Israel has a right to defend itself. We reiterate our support for the security of Israel. We also affirm the importance of the protection of civilians,” the statement read.</p>
<p>The G7 nations also labelled Iran as the principal source of instability and terror in the region.&nbsp;</p>
<p>”Iran is the principal source of regional instability and terror. We have been consistently clear that Iran can never have a nuclear weapon. We urge that the resolution of the Iranian crisis leads to a broader de-escalation of hostilities in the Middle East, including a ceasefire in Gaza.&nbsp;</p>
<p>We will remain vigilant to the implications for international energy markets and stand ready to coordinate, including with like-minded partners, to safeguard market stability,” the G7 leaders’ statement read.</p>
<p>Meanwhile, US President Donald Trump has left the G7 summit early, indicating that he is trying to strike a deal with Iran to end the conflict. French President Emmanuel Macron told reporters at the G7 summit that Trump has made an offer for a ceasefire between Israel and Iran, CNN reported.</p>
<p>”There is an offer that has been made, especially to have a ceasefire and to initiate broader discussions,” Macron told reporters.</p>
<p>”If the United States of America can achieve a ceasefire, it is a very good thing and France will support it, and we wish for it,” Macron added.</p>
<p>Earlier, Trump posted on Truth Social, urging people to evacuate Iran and strongly advocating the case for Iran not to have a nuclear weapon.</p>
<p>”Iran should have signed the ‘deal” I told them to sign. What a shame, and a waste of human life. Simply stated, Iran cannot have a nuclear weapon. I have said it over and over again! Everyone should immediately evacuate Tehran!” he posted</p>
<p>”America First means many great things, including the fact that Iran cannot have a nuclear weapon. Make America great again, he said in another post.<br />The Israel-Iran conflict is in its fifth day, with both sides trading missile strikes. Civilians in key areas face waves of attacks. According to a CNN report, in Iran, at least 224 people have been killed since hostilities began. In Israel, 24 people have been killed.</p>
